Understanding Transportation Options

Tijuana offers various transportation options for travelers heading to the airport. These options include taxis, private shuttles, public buses, and ridesharing services. Each mode of transportation has its advantages and disadvantages, depending on factors such as cost, convenience, and comfort.

Taxis are a common choice for travelers seeking a direct and convenient ride to the airport. While taxis provide door-to-door service and can accommodate luggage, they can be more expensive than other transportation options. Additionally, travelers should ensure they use reputable taxi companies to avoid scams or overcharging.

Private shuttles offer another convenient option for airport transportation in Tijuana. These shuttles provide shared or private rides to the airport, offering comfort and flexibility for travelers. However, booking in advance is recommended to ensure availability and avoid long wait times.

Public buses are a more budget-friendly option for travelers on a tight budget. While buses may take longer to reach the airport due to multiple stops, they offer a cost-effective way to travel. Travelers should research bus routes and schedules in advance to plan their journey accordingly.

Ridesharing services have become increasingly popular in Tijuana, providing travelers with a convenient and affordable transportation option. Services like Uber and Lyft offer rides to the airport at competitive prices, with the added convenience of booking and tracking rides through mobile apps.

Navigating Transportation Challenges

Despite the availability of transportation options, navigating Tijuana can present challenges for travelers, particularly those unfamiliar with the city. Traffic congestion, language barriers, and safety concerns are some of the common challenges travelers may encounter when traveling to the airport.

Traffic congestion is a prevalent issue in Tijuana, especially during peak travel times. Travelers should allow extra time for their journey to account for potential delays caused by traffic congestion. Planning ahead and staying updated on traffic conditions can help travelers avoid missing their flights due to traffic delays.

Language barriers can also pose challenges for travelers navigating Tijuana. While many locals in Tijuana speak Spanish, English-speaking travelers may encounter difficulties communicating with taxi drivers or navigating public transportation. Travelers are advised to learn basic Spanish phrases or carry a translation app to facilitate communication during their journey.

Safety concerns are another important consideration when navigating Tijuana, particularly for travelers using taxis or public transportation. While Tijuana is generally safe for tourists, travelers should exercise caution and use reputable transportation providers to ensure their safety. Avoiding unlicensed taxis and unfamiliar areas can help travelers minimize the risk of encountering safety issues.

Tips for Hassle-Free Transportation

To ensure a hassle-free journey to the airport in Tijuana, travelers can follow these tips:

  1. Plan Ahead: Research transportation options and plan your journey to the airport in advance to avoid last-minute stress.

  2. Book in Advance: If using private shuttles or ridesharing services, book your ride to the airport in advance to secure availability and avoid long wait times.

  3. Allow Extra Time: Factor in extra time for your journey to account for potential traffic delays or unexpected circumstances.

  4. Communicate Clearly: If communicating in Spanish, use basic phrases or a translation app to communicate effectively with taxi drivers or transportation providers.

  5. Use Reputable Providers: Choose reputable taxi companies, private shuttles, or ridesharing services to ensure a safe and reliable journey to the airport.
